WebThe lymphatic system helps us fight infection. Lymphedema occurs when there is a build-up of lymph fluid in the tissues. This causes swelling, mostly in the arms or legs. This swelling can become chronic and trigger changes in your skin and tissues that put you at risk for additional swelling, infections, and decreased mobility. WebJan 17, 2024 · Lymphedema is an abnormal accumulation of protein-rich fluid in the tissues that causes swelling in the arms, legs and/or trunk. It most commonly occurs after surgery, radiation therapy or chemotherapy, or because of infection, obesity, inadequate blood flow in the veins, trauma, or recovery from joint replacement and other surgeries.
